WebBright Star is a 2009 biographical romantic drama film, written and directed by Jane Campion.It is based on the last three years of the life of poet John Keats (played by Ben Whishaw) and his romantic relationship with Fanny … Bright Star is a musical written and composed by Steve Martin and Edie Brickell. It is set in the Blue Ridge Mountains of North Carolina in 1945–46 with flashbacks to 1923. The musical is inspired by their Grammy-winning collaboration on the 2013 bluegrass album Love Has Come for You and, in turn, the folk story of the Iron Mountain Baby. floating point exception: invalid number
